Viteese throttle controler hands down. little over 150 but not by much. Best bang for the buck out there.
+1

Just about everything else in that price range is for noise (effect). Other performance mods, with arguably nominal gains, cost more than $150. This mod actually improves the driving experience and launch. With just this controller some members have seen a few tenths of a second shaved from their 0-60 times. I can believe it, car is very responsive.
